Casement Window Benefits: Ventilation, Views, and Energy Savings
Casement windows offer choice for homeowners seeking to maximize both ventilation and energy efficiency. With their characteristic outward-swinging design, casement windows enable significant airflow, creating a comfortable indoor environment. Moreover, their full-frame pane area provides unobstructed views of the outdoors, enhancing any room with natural light and a sense of airiness.
Furthermore, casement windows are known for their excellent energy efficiency. Their design helps to contain your home, minimizing heating and cooling costs. A variety of casement windows come with features such as double-paned glass and advanced sealing to significantly enhance their energy-saving features.

Choosing the Right Window for Every Room: A Comparative Look
When it comes to outfitting your home with windows, a one-size-fits-all approach rarely works. Each room possesses unique requirements, demanding different window styles and features. Evaluate the purpose of each space: a sun-drenched kitchen might benefit from expansive picture windows to maximize natural light, while a cozy bedroom calls for privacy-enhancing options. Allow us explore various window types and how they can transform your living areas.
- Casement windows provide ventilation and are perfect in smaller spaces.
- Bow windows create a charming focal point and add extra square footage.
- Sliding windows offer versatile options for light control and energy efficiency.
